Elected Officials Volunteer on Thanksgiving

During this challenging year, we were so honored to be joined by many of our elected officials and their staff as we celebrated our largest Thanksgiving yet at God’s Love. This year was particularly special as the need for God’s Love We Deliver’s services has increased significantly during this pandemic. We are thankful to our elected officials for joining us in our kitchen bright and early to volunteer their time to make Thanksgiving meals for our vulnerable clients, children, and caregivers. Thanksgiving really is a special time at God’s Love, and we were so happy to share the holiday with those who serve our community.

We were joined by State Senator Brian Kavanagh and his staff, as well as State Senator Brad Hoylman, and City Council Member Carlina Rivera who together helped pack out over 10,000 Thanksgiving feasts that were then delivered to clients living with serious illness.  These meals made their way throughout the five boroughs of New York City as well as Westchester, Nassau, and Hudson County New Jersey.

A special thank you to our public officials for volunteering their time to make this Thanksgiving a truly special event for our clients at God’s Love. We were so pleased to have a chance to share our mission with you and demonstrate the impact our services have on our clients every day.
